Aims : to discuss important topics in paediatric respiratory medicine such as: 1) treatment options for severe paediatric asthma, 2) an insight into neutrophilic inflammation following preterm birth and other relevant lung diseases, 3) management of persistent obstructive sleep apnoea (OSA) in children and 4) high-flow nasal cannula therapy in paediatric respiratory insufficiency;
